Glen Mays is a bodybuilder from the United States with a competitive record spanning 2005–2008.
Across 6 recorded contest results, Glen Mays has 3 first-place finishes (a 50% win rate).
Win rate here is first-place finishes as a share of all 6 recorded contest results. It is published only where a career holds at least five, because below that a single placing moves the figure by twenty points or more.

All results
Every contest result on record for Glen Mays, 6 in all. Won by names the winner of the division Glen Mays competed in, and shows a dash where that winner cannot be pinned to one person in the database.
| Year | Contest | Division | Place | Won by |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2008 | Eastern USA Championships | Other Divisions | #1 | Winner |
| 2008 | Eastern USA Championships | Other Divisions | #1 | Winner |
| 2005 | Keystone State Classic | Other Divisions | #1 | Winner |
| 2005 | Keystone State Classic | Other Divisions | #3 | Jim Feese |
| 2005 | US Open | Other Divisions | #2 | Joseph Bastardi |
| 2005 | US Open | Other Divisions | #4 | Frank Ulrich |
